Who We Are; What We Do; Where We’re Going
 
Magnet Forensics is a global leader in the development of digital investigative software that acquires, analyzes, and shares evidence from computers, smartphones, tablets, and IoT-related devices. We are continually innovating so our customers can deploy advanced and effective tools to protect their companies, communities, and countries.
 
Serving thousands of customers globally, our solutions are playing a crucial role in modernizing digital investigations, helping investigators fight crime, protect assets, and guard national security.

Role Overview

The Account Manager is responsible for developing and expanding relationships with existing customers, ensuring customer success, maximizing the value customers realize from Magnet Forensics’ solutions, and identifying opportunities to grow customer adoption across our portfolio of products and services.

What You’ll Do

  • Develop and execute annual and quarterly account growth and customer success plans
  • Build trusted relationships with key stakeholders across law enforcement and government organizations
  • Help drive customer retention and long-term account development
  • Identify opportunities for cross-sell and upsell within existing customer accounts
  • Conduct regular business reviews and customer success discussions to understand evolving customer needs
  • Prepare and deliver customer presentations, solution overviews, and value-based discussions
  • Coordinate and support product evaluations, upgrades, and adoption initiatives
  • Accurately manage quotations, renewals, and related commercial processes
  • Maintain complete and accurate records of all customer engagements and opportunities within Magnet’s CRM system
  • Collaborate closely with Customer Success, Technical Specialists, and Marketing teams to ensure outstanding customer outcomes
  • Serve as a strategic advisor by helping customers achieve their operational and investigative objectives through the effective use of Magnet solutions
  • Act as the voice of the customer internally, providing feedback to product and leadership teams

What We’re Looking For

  • Experience managing and growing customer relationships in a software, technology, or services environment
  • Strong consultative commun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Proven ability to drive customer retention, expansion, and long-term account growth
  • Ability to understand customer challenges and align solutions to business outcomes
  • Previous Law Enforcement or Digital Forensic experience is an asset
  • *There will be some travel required for this role and it can be expected about 25% of the time
